#b642c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b642c3 is composed of 71.4% red, 25.9%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.7%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 294 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 51.2%. #b642c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ff84ff with #6d0087.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#b642c3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b642c3 has RGB values of R:182, G:66,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 11944643.

Shades and Tints of #b642c3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040105 is the darkest color, while #fbf5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b642c3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#887b8a is the less saturated color, while #e409fc is the most saturated one.
